1 /* Generated by tuneup.c, 2014-04-04, gcc 4.6 */
2 
3 #define MUL_KARATSUBA_THRESHOLD          10
4 #define MUL_TOOM3_THRESHOLD             113
5 #define MUL_TOOM4_THRESHOLD             197
6 #define MUL_TOOM8H_THRESHOLD            199
7 
8 
9 #define SQR_BASECASE_THRESHOLD            0  /* always (native) */
10 #define SQR_KARATSUBA_THRESHOLD          16
11 #define SQR_TOOM3_THRESHOLD             105
12 #define SQR_TOOM4_THRESHOLD             278
13 #define SQR_TOOM8_THRESHOLD             286
14 
15 #define POWM_THRESHOLD                   59
16 
17 #define HGCD_THRESHOLD                   70
18 #define GCD_DC_THRESHOLD                192
19 #define GCDEXT_DC_THRESHOLD             169
20 #define JACOBI_BASE_METHOD                3
21 
22 
23 #define DIVREM_1_NORM_THRESHOLD       MP_SIZE_T_MAX  /* never */
24 #define DIVREM_1_UNNORM_THRESHOLD     MP_SIZE_T_MAX  /* never */
25 #define MOD_1_NORM_THRESHOLD              0  /* always */
26 #define MOD_1_UNNORM_THRESHOLD            0  /* always */
27 
28 #define USE_PREINV_DIVREM_1               1  /* native */
29 #define USE_PREINV_MOD_1                  1
30 #define DIVEXACT_1_THRESHOLD              0  /* always */
31 
32 #define MODEXACT_1_ODD_THRESHOLD          0  /* always (native) */
33 #define MOD_1_1_THRESHOLD                 7
34 #define MOD_1_2_THRESHOLD                 8
35 #define MOD_1_3_THRESHOLD                12
36 #define DIVREM_HENSEL_QR_1_THRESHOLD    126
37 #define RSH_DIVREM_HENSEL_QR_1_THRESHOLD    996
38 #define DIVREM_EUCLID_HENSEL_THRESHOLD     58
39 
40 #define ROOTREM_THRESHOLD                 6
41 
42 #define GET_STR_DC_THRESHOLD             20
43 #define GET_STR_PRECOMPUTE_THRESHOLD     25
44 #define SET_STR_DC_THRESHOLD            248
45 #define SET_STR_PRECOMPUTE_THRESHOLD    262
46 
47 #define MUL_FFT_FULL_THRESHOLD         2496
48 
49 #define SQR_FFT_FULL_THRESHOLD         1760
50 
51 #define MULLOW_BASECASE_THRESHOLD         0  /* always */
52 #define MULLOW_DC_THRESHOLD              12
53 #define MULLOW_MUL_THRESHOLD           2324
54 
55 #define MULHIGH_BASECASE_THRESHOLD        8
56 #define MULHIGH_DC_THRESHOLD              8
57 #define MULHIGH_MUL_THRESHOLD          2257
58 
59 #define MULMOD_2EXPM1_THRESHOLD          14
60 
61 #define FAC_UI_THRESHOLD               8252
62 #define DC_DIV_QR_THRESHOLD              28
63 #define DC_DIVAPPR_Q_N_THRESHOLD         14
64 #define INV_DIV_QR_THRESHOLD           1442
65 #define INV_DIVAPPR_Q_N_THRESHOLD        14
66 #define DC_DIV_Q_THRESHOLD               73
67 #define INV_DIV_Q_THRESHOLD            2801
68 #define DC_DIVAPPR_Q_THRESHOLD           10
69 #define INV_DIVAPPR_Q_THRESHOLD        7881
70 #define DC_BDIV_QR_THRESHOLD             28
71 #define DC_BDIV_Q_THRESHOLD              34
72 
73 
74 /* fft_tuning -- autogenerated by tune-fft */
75 
76 #define FFT_TAB \
77    { { 4, 3 }, { 3, 2 }, { 3, 2 }, { 2, 1 }, { 1, 0 } }
78 
79 #define MULMOD_TAB \
80    { 4, 3, 3, 4, 4, 3, 3, 3, 3, 2, 2, 2, 3, 2, 2, 2, 2, 1, 1 }
81 
82 #define FFT_N_NUM 19
83 
84 #define FFT_MULMOD_2EXPP1_CUTOFF 128
85 
86 
87 /* Tuneup completed successfully, took 565 seconds */
88 
89